Copy eBooks and PDFs to Kindle Folder. Basically all that you have to do is copy the ebook or PDF file into the Kindle folder. Use a file manager app (I use ES File Explorer in the video below) to locate the PDF or ebook that you want to load into Kindle for Android, and then move it to the Kindle folder. Something else, I just recently found that Kindle on my iPad handles .pdf files very well, although no dictionary functionality is available. Go to your Kindle Personal Documents Settings page. Under Approved Personal Document E-mail List, add your email address. Under Send-to-Kindle E-Mail Settings, find and record your Kindle's email address. This address should end in @kindle.com. This is the address that you will send PDF files to. I want to read a PDF with the Kindle app on my Galaxy 10.1 I found lots of posts about converting PDF's for Kindle, but that's not my problem.
